                        The Press release in the tweet which sezenack posted:

                        The Collingwood Blues are pleased to announce (03) defenceman Payton Robinson has been acquired in exchange for (01) forward Matthew Zebedee & (02) forward Nathan Naves.

                        Director of Hockey Ops Jordan Selinger had this to say at the time of the transaction on the outgoing players, “We would like to thank Matthew and Nathan for all that they have done for Collingwood, and wish them nothing but the best in their careers going forward”

                        Selinger expects Payton, 17 to be a big part of the future in Collingwood. He comes to Collingwood after a successful OJHL rookie season in Burlington, his hometown. “Payton is going to be a big piece on our backend, at 6’3 with great skating ability and hockey sense, Payton checks several boxes for us and is among the elite at his position in our league. We feel that Payton has a great shot to suit up for Team Canada East in this year’s World Jr A Challenge. He is currently committed to play Division 1 Hockey at RPI, and is our first of what we are hoping is many more commits to come in Collingwood.”

                        Last season he put up 2 goals and 13 assists for 15 points in 46 games with 14 penalty minutes with the Burlington Cougars. Robinson weighs in at 190 lbs measuring 6 foot 3 inches tall. He is committed to RPI Division 1 for the 2022/2023 season.

                        Welcome to Collingwood Payton Robinson!!!
                        This agrees that PR is a 2022 recruit.
